Familicide is rare; however, the high victim counts in each incident and context surrounding these killings underscore the need for further research. The purpose of this study is to gain a better understanding of the circumstances surrounding familicide in Canada. Using univariate statistics, this study analyzed 26 incidents of familicide that occurred in Canada between 2010 and 2019. The results show that familicide is a gendered crime involving primarily male accused who often target female victims, have a history of domestic violence, and commit the killings using firearms. This research highlights the importance of developing risk assessment, risk management, and safety planning strategies to address warning signs and prevent future familicides.

Acidimicrobium sp. strain A6 is a recently discovered autotrophic bacterium that is capable of oxidizing ammonium while reducing ferric iron and is relatively common in acidic iron-rich soils. The genome of Acidimicrobium sp. strain A6 contains sequences for several reductive dehalogenases, including a gene for a previously unreported reductive dehalogenase, rdhA. Incubations of Acidimicrobium sp. strain A6 in the presence of perfluorinated substances, such as PFOA (perfluorooctanoic acid, C8HF15O2) or PFOS (perfluorooctane sulfonic acid, C8HF17O3S), have shown that fluoride, as well as shorter carbon chain PFAAs (perfluoroalkyl acids), are being produced, and the rdhA gene is expressed during these incubations. Results from initial gene knockout experiments indicate that the enzyme associated with the rdhA gene plays a key role in the PFAS defluorination by Acidimicrobium sp. strain A6. Experiments focusing on the defluorination kinetics by Acidimicrobium sp. strain A6 show that the defluorination kinetics are proportional to the amount of ammonium oxidized. To explore potential applications for PFAS bioremediation, PFAS-contaminated biosolids were augmented with Fe(III) and Acidimicrobium sp. strain A6, resulting in PFAS degradation. Since the high demand of Fe(III) makes growing Acidimicrobium sp. strain A6 in conventional rectors challenging, and since Acidimicrobium sp. strain A6 was shown to be electrogenic, it was grown in the absence of Fe(III) in microbial electrolysis cells, where it did oxidize ammonium and degraded PFAS.

Acidimicrobium sp. Strain A6 (A6) can degrade perfluoroalkyl acids (PFAAs) by oxidizing NH4+ while reducing Fe(Ⅲ). However, supplying and distributing Fe(III) phases in sediments is challenging since surface charges of Fe(III)-phases are typically positive while those of sediments are negative. Therefore, ferrihydrite particles were coated with polyacrylic acid (PAA) with four different molecular weights, resulting in a negative zeta potential on their surface. Zeta potential was determined as a function of pH and PAA loading, with the lowest value observed when the PAA/ferrihydrite ratio was > 1/5 (w/w) at a pH of 5.5. Several 50-day incubations with an A6-enrichment culture were conducted to determine the effect of PAA-coated ferrihydrite as the electron acceptor of A6 on the Feammox activity and PFOA degradation. NH4+ oxidation, PFOA degradation, production of shorter-chain PFAS, and F- were observed in all PAA-coated samples. The 6 K and 450 K treatments exhibited significant reductions in PFOA concentration and substantial F- production compared to incubations with bare ferrihydrite. Electrochemical impedance spectroscopy showed lowered charge transfer resistance in the presence of PAA-coated ferrihydrite, indicating that PAAs facilitated electron transfer to ferrihydrite. This study highlights the potential of PAA-coated ferrihydrite in accelerating PFAS defluorination, providing novel insights for A6-based bioremediation strategies.

Per- and polyfluoroalkyl substances (PFAS) are emerging contaminants of concern due to their health effects and persistence in the environment. Although perfluoroalkyl acids (PFAAs), such as perfluorooctanoic acid (PFOA) and perfluorooctanesulfonic acid (PFOS) are very difficult to biodegrade because they are completely saturated with fluorine, it has recently been shown that Acidimicrobium sp. A6 (A6), which oxidizes ammonium under iron reducing conditions (Feammox process), can defluorinate PFAAs. A kinetic model was developed and tested in this study using results from previously published laboratory experiments, augmented with results from additional incubations, to couple the Feammox process to PFAS defluorination. The experimental results show higher Feammox activity and PFAS degradation in the A6 enrichment cultures than in the highly enriched A6 cultures. The coupled experimental and modeling results show that the PFAS defluorination rate is proportional to the rate of ammonium oxidation. The ammonium oxidation rate and the defluorination rate increase monotonically, but not linearly, with increasing A6 biomass. Given that different experiments had different level of Feammox activity, the parameters required to simulate the Feammox varied between A6 cultures. Nonetheless, the kinetic model was able to simulate an anaerobic incubation system and show that PFAS defluorination is proportional to the Feammox activity.

Purpose: Children exposed to domestic violence are at risk of adverse short- and long-term psychosocial effects and of being abused themselves. However, mothers and children face systemic gaps when seeking safety from domestic violence services and police. Safety planning typically focuses on women, overlooking their multiple social identities and excluding their children. We explored safety strategies used by mothers and children coping together with severe domestic violence. Method: Interviews with 30 mothers who experienced severe or potentially life-threatening domestic violence and 5 adults who experienced domestic violence in childhood were qualitatively analyzed using thematic analysis, revealing five major themes: ongoing communication, appeasing the abuser, soothing activities, exposure reduction, and fostering independence. Results: Interpreting participants' experiences in terms of the mother-child dyad, we found that mothers and their children worked together to reassure each other, keep each other safe, and make plans to leave their abuser. Conclusions: Safety planning for the mother-child dyad could build on children's existing coping strategies and recognize and support children's desire to protect their mother and themselves effectively and safely according to their developmental stage.

Assessing risk in domestic violence situations is foundational to ensuring safety. Although there is growing information about the reliability and validity of a variety of risk assessment tools across different practice contexts, there is a paucity of research on the feasibility and application of these tools in real world settings. The present qualitative study examined current practices in domestic violence risk assessment in Canada through a survey of professionals working across diverse sectors. Utilizing a thematic analysis of 255 open-text responses, this study presents several themes related to challenges identified at the systemic, organizational, and individual levels. Themes related to promising practices and the practical implication of risk assessment strategies are also explored.

Acidimicrobiaceae sp. strain A6 (A6), is an anaerobic autotrophic bacterium capable of oxidizing ammonium (NH4+) while reducing ferric iron and is also able to defluorinate PFAS under these growth conditions. A6 is exoelectrogenic and can grow in microbial electrolysis cells (MECs) by using the anode as the electron acceptor in lieu of ferric iron. Therefore, cultures of A6 amended with perfluorooctanoic acid (PFOA) were incubated in MECs to investigate its ability to defluorinate PFAS in such reactors. Results show a significant decrease in PFOA concentration after 18 days of operation, while producing current and removing NH4+. The buildup of fluoride and shorter chain perfluorinated products was detected only in MECs with applied potential, active A6, and amended with PFOA, confirming the biodegradation of PFOA in these systems. This work sets the stage for further studies on the application of A6-based per- and polyfluorinated alkyl substances (PFAS) bioremediation in microbial electrochemical systems for water treatment.

This study examined the role of police in domestic homicide cases reviewed by a multidisciplinary death review committee in Ontario, Canada. Examining the 219 domestic homicide case summaries, this study explored the difference between homicides with, and without, prior police contact. Results indicated that police contacted cases had 63% more risk factors present compared with cases without prior police contact, with 80% of police-involved cases having 10 or more risk factors. Police cases had unique risk factors present including a failure to comply with authority, access to victims after risk assessments, prior threats to kill victims (including with a weapon), history of domestic violence (DV), extreme minimization of DV, addiction concerns, and an escalation of violence. Cases involving child homicide have unique child-specific risk factors such as custody disputes, threats to children, and abuse during pregnancy. Overall, there was a lack of formal risk assessments conducted. Implications are discussed in terms of police intervention being a critical opportunity for risk assessment, safety planning, and risk management. Although there is no certainty in predicting that lives would have been saved, the level of risk presented calls for enhanced efforts at assessment and intervention for adult victims and their children.

Through interviews with police officers (n = 15), the present study examined police perspectives toward their response to intimate partner violence (IPV). Qualitative analyses indicated several challenges police officers face in responding to IPV, including barriers at the systemic, organizational, and individual levels. Police officers in the current study also identified recommendations toward overcoming barriers. Overall, results continue to underscore a lack of police consistency toward addressing IPV, including inconsistent approaches to assessing and managing risk posed to families. Conversely, qualitative results point to several recommendations that heavily involve collaboration between community and justice partners. Implications for future research and practice include further examination of the identified recommendations, a continued focus on developing training that addresses the risk posed to high-risk families, and further development of collaborative approaches toward the prevention and intervention of IPV.

Anaerobic incubations were performed with biosolids obtained from an industrial wastewater treatment plant (WWTP) that contained perfluorooctanoic acid (PFOA), and with per- and polyfluoroalkyl substances- (PFAS) free, laboratory-generated, biosolids that were spiked with PFOA. Biosolid slurries were incubated for 150 days as is, after augmenting with either Acidimicrobium sp. Strain A6 or ferrihydrite, or with both, Acidimicrobium sp. Strain A6 and ferrihydrite. Autoclaved controls were run in parallel. Only the biosolids augmented with both, Acidimicrobium sp. Strain A6 and ferrihydrite showed a decrease in the PFOA concentration, in excess of 50% (total, dissolved, and solid associated). Higher concentrations of PFOA in the biosolids spiked with PFOA and no previous PFAS exposure allowed to track the production of fluoride to verify PFOA defluorination. The buildup of fluoride over the incubation time was observed in these biosolid incubations spiked with PFOA. A significant increase in the concentration of perfluoroheptanoic acid (PFHpA) over the incubations of the filter cake samples from the industrial WWTP was observed, indicating the presence of a non-identified precursor in these biosolids. Results show that anaerobic incubation of PFAS contaminated biosolids, after augmentation with Fe(III) and Acidimicrobium sp. Strain A6 can result in PFAS defluorination.

Frequent and intense storm disturbances can have widespread and strong effects on the nitrogen and iron cycles and their associated microbial communities in estuary systems. A three-year investigation was conducted in the Pearl River and Zhanjiang estuaries in Guangdong Province, China through repeated sampling at three timepoints, defined as pre-storm (<1 month before storm), post-storm (<1 month after storm), and non-storm (6-8 months after storm). Increased nutrient concentrations (total organic carbon, nitrate, nitrite, ammonium, and sulfate) in both the sediment and water column were observed immediately after storm. The microbial community experienced extensive and immediate changes determined by an observed composition shift in the nitrogen and iron-cycling microbiomes. Analysis of sediment samples displayed a shift from nitrogen-to sulfur-cycling microorganisms and an increase in microbial interactions that were not observed in the water column. The chemical profile and microbial community components both returned to baseline conditions 6-8 months following storm disturbance. Finally, significant correlations were found between chemical and microbial data, suggesting that niche-sharing microbes may respond similarly to stimuli that impact their ecosystem. Increases in nutrient availability can favor the abundance of specific taxa, as demonstrated by an increase in Acidimicrobium that affect both nitrogen and iron cycling.

Through interviews the present study examined the perspectives of service providers (n = 14) in the violence against women (VAW) sector regarding risk factors and challenges in assessing risk for women experiencing domestic violence (DV) in rural locations. The present study also examined what promising practices VAW service providers are utilizing when working with women experiencing DV in rural locations. Interviews were coded and analyzed in a qualitative analysis computer program. Analysis indicated several risk factors including the location (i.e., geographic isolation, lack of transportation, and lack of community resources) and cultural factors (i.e., accepted and more available use of firearms, poverty, and no privacy/anonymity). Moreover, analyses indicated several challenges for VAW service providers assessing risk including barriers at the systemic (i.e., lack of agreement between services), organizational (i.e., lack of collaboration and risk assessment being underutilized/valued), and individual client (i.e., complexity of issues) level. However, participants outlined promising practices being implemented for rural locations such as interagency collaboration, public education, professional education, and outreach programs. The findings support other research in the field that highlight the increased vulnerability of women experiencing DV in rural locations and the added barriers and complexities in assessing risk for rural populations. Implications for future research and practice include further examination of the identified promising practices, a continued focus on collaborative approaches and innovative ways to prevent and manage risk in a rural context.

Almost 40% of murdered women are victims of domestic homicide across the world. However, research has yet to examine comorbid depression and substance abuse in domestic homicide perpetrators, despite comorbid mental health conditions being associated with homicide in the general population. A retrospective case analysis approach was performed using domestic homicide cases that had been reviewed by the Domestic Violence Death Review Committee in Ontario, Canada. Group comparisons were made by compiling cases into groups based on perpetrators with depression and/or substance abuse: a no history of depression and/or substance use group, depression only group, substance abuse only group, and comorbid depression and substance abuse group. Statistical analyses compared groups on number and types of risk factors and service provider contacts. A major finding of the current study was the resounding lack of mental health care and batterer intervention program engagement across groups. Results also indicated that perpetrators with comorbid depression and substance abuse have an elevated number of risk factors for domestic homicide and elevated number of service provider contacts. Furthermore, results indicated that perpetrators with comorbid depression and substance abuse had an increased likelihood of having engaged in hostage-taking behavior and increased likelihood of having contact with mental health and health care providers. The study demonstrates the necessity for future research into the barriers associated with help-seeking by perpetrators, family and friends, as well as the barriers to agency referral and to mental health agencies providing service to perpetrators. It also highlights the need for service providers to take multiple mental health conditions into account when working with perpetrators of domestic homicide. Overall, this study underscores the importance of mental health and domestic violence training for service providers in different sectors. Moreover, it emphasizes the necessity of collaboration among service providers to address both violence-specific and mental health-specific concerns in perpetrators of domestic violence.

Male depression has been recognized as an important factor in some cases of intimate partner violence but there is a paucity of literature connecting depression and intimate partner homicide (IPH). This retrospective study provides a preliminary analysis that distinguished depressed from nondepressed perpetrators of IPH from a sample of 135 cases analyzed by a coroner's homicide death review committee in Ontario, Canada. Depressed perpetrators were more likely to commit homicide-suicide and had almost 1.5 times the number of risk factors present than nondepressed perpetrators. Consistent with the existing literature, the results indicated that depressed perpetrators were significantly older, more likely to commit homicide-suicide than homicide only, more likely to have prior threats or attempts of suicide, more likely to have been abused or witnessed domestic violence as a child than nondepressed perpetrators and more likely to exhibit sexual jealousy. The implications for these findings are outlined in terms of training of mental health professionals and public awareness about the potential lethality of domestic violence.

Due to their health effects and the recalcitrant nature of their CF bonds, Poly- and Perfluoroalkyl Substances (PFAS) are widely investigated for their distribution, remediation, and toxicology in ecosystems. However, very few studies have focused on modeling PFAS in the soil-water environment. In this review, we summarized the recent development in PFAS modeling for various chemical, physical, and biological processes, including sorption, volatilization, degradation, bioaccumulation, and transport. PFAS sorption is kinetic in nature with sorption equilibrium commonly quantified by either a linear, the Freundlich, or the Langmuir isotherms. Volatilization of PFAS depends on carbon chain length and ionization status and has been simulated by a two-layer diffusion process across the air water interface. First-order kinetics is commonly used for physical, chemical, and biological degradation processes. Uptake by plants and other biota can be passive and/or active. As surfactants, PFAS have a tendency to be sorbed or concentrated on air-water or non-aqueous phase liquid (NAPL)-water interfaces, where the same three isotherms for soil sorption are adopted. PFAS transport in the soil-water environment is simulated by solving the convection-dispersion equation (CDE) that is coupled to PFAS sorption, phase transfer, as well as physical, chemical, and biological transformations. As the physicochemical properties and concentration vary greatly among the potentially thousands of PFAS species in the environment, systematic efforts are needed to identify models and model parameters to simulate their fate, transport, and response to remediation techniques. Since many process formulations are empirical in nature, mechanistic approaches are needed to further the understanding of PFAS-soil-water-plant interactions so that the model parameters are less site dependent and more predictive in simulating PFAS remediation efficiency.

Children are harmed by exposure to domestic violence (DV) and in extreme cases can become homicide victims themselves. A critical role for police responding to domestic violence calls is to assess risk for future violence. Training and procedural guidelines for assessment and intervention are often focused on adult victims, and children tend to be overlooked. OBJECTIVE: The objective of the current study is to identify the challenges police officers perceive in dealing with children in the context of DV occurrences. PARTICIPANTS, SETTING & METHODS: Interviews with police officers (n = 15) in Ontario, Canada were used to explore police officers' experiences addressing the needs of families experiencing DV. A dual deductive/inductive approach to a thematic analysis at the semantic level was undertaken (Braun & Clarke, 2006) to explore themes. RESULTS: The major themes from the interviews centered on: (a) challenges relating to knowledge, skills, and resources; (b) challenges from discrepancies in required procedures; and (c) challenges associated to police relations with families. These challenges all impact the police response to children in DV occurrences. CONCLUSIONS: Police recognize the challenges they face in addressing children in DV occurrences. The implications for improved practice are discussed and include the need for increased collaboration, awareness, and training.

Autotrophic denitrification under acidic conditions using sulfide (S2-), elemental sulfur (S0), and thiosulfate (S2O32-) as electron donors are evaluated. Results from batch and column experiments show that when different S species were supplied, different pH conditions and denitrifier communities were required for denitrification to occur. Nitrate and nitrite were removed via autotrophic denitrification at pH ranging from 4 to 8, when S2- or S2O32- was the electron donor, while with S0 denitrification was only observed at pH > 6. When S2- was used as electron donor, it was converted to S0, and S0 was not used while S2- was available. When addition of S2- was discontinued, or S2- depleted, S0 that had accumulated was used as electron donor for denitrification. These findings demonstrate that sulfur-based autotrophic denitrification can proceed under acidic conditions, but that the addition of appropriate S species and the presence of an effective denitrifier community are required.

BACKGROUND: The needs of children exposed to domestic violence have been historically overlooked. One way in which service provision for children exposed to this violence can be explored is through an examination of Domestic Violence Fatality Review Teams (DVFRT's), who review cases of fatal domestic violence to identify possible areas for improvement. OBJECTIVE: This study explored key themes relative to children exposed to domestic violence and homicide published by DVFRT's in order to identify the services that exist for children exposed to domestic violence, barriers to providing these services, and recommendations for improvement. PARTICIPANTS AND SETTING: This study reviewed annual reports from three DVFRT jurisdictions with regular annual reports from 2004 to 2016. METHODS: A generic thematic analysis was performed by the primary author, in consultation with the second author, in order to identify dominant themes present in the DVFRT annual reports. The analysis utilized a codebook that was created beforehand in order to capture pertinent information within the reports. Trustworthiness of the data was established through a consistent application and thorough reporting of the coding procedures. RESULTS: The analysis highlighted key barriers to child-specific service provision among agencies involved (e.g., lack of professional training and public awareness), recommendations for enhanced intervention (e.g., enhanced child-specific services) and promising practices (e.g., policy and legislation development). CONCLUSIONS: The three DVFRTs identified several gaps in service provision for children affected by fatal domestic violence that will require increased engagement and resources targeting these vulnerable children.

Incubations with pure and enrichment cultures of Acidimicrobium sp. strain A6 (A6), an autotroph that oxidizes ammonium to nitrite while reducing ferric iron, were conducted in the presence of PFOA or PFOS at 0.1 mg/L and 100 mg/L. Buildup of fluoride, shorter-chain perfluorinated products, and acetate was observed, as well as a decrease in Fe(III) reduced per ammonium oxidized. Incubations with hydrogen as a sole electron donor also resulted in the defluorination of these PFAS. Removal of up to 60% of PFOA and PFOS was observed during 100 day incubations, while total fluorine (organic plus fluoride) remained constant throughout the incubations. To determine if PFOA/PFOS or some of their degradation products were metabolized, and since no organic carbon source except these PFAS was added, dissolved organic carbon (DOC) was tracked. At concentrations of 100 mg/L, PFOA/PFOS were the main contributors to DOC, which remained constant during the pure A6 culture incubations. Whereas in the A6 enrichment culture, DOC decreased slightly with time, indicating that as defluorination of PFOS/PFOA occurred, some of the products were being metabolized by heterotrophs present in this culture. Results show that A6 can defluorinate PFOA/PFOS while reducing iron, using ammonium or hydrogen as the electron donor.
